A Baby Born

                        A baby born

O baby! I shall name you the blissful joy,

No name equals you but a heavenly toy,

In your clenched fist, hides future world,

With a goal I know not, you were hurled.

 

Stars blink in your eyes, the strobe’s beam,

Nature may have planned true, my dream!

Purring and smiling, then innocently awake,

The bliss pours in fast, of your angelic wake.

 

Your smiles and chuckles, dimples and face,

Styles my heart fonder, to my breast I brace,

Swathed in plush, and cozy, I’ll kiss you soon,

Swinging in my arms, I swing heaven’s boon.

 

Sweeter than honey, you are my heart’s beat,

You are a sneaking angel to cleanse and treat,

In a single sweep, my qualms lingering so long,

You, a rare pearl, sparkling in a million’s throng.

 

You have swapped my gloom with moonlit night,

My spirits boom to skies with the sprightly might,

May ye live long and pure in coming days and life,

Clean, above whims or shade in thy glittery strife.
